2025 Compare Climate & Weather:
Tyler, TX vs Tullahoma, TN

Change Cities
Highlights

On average, there are 205 sunny days per year in Tullahoma. Tyler averages 218 sunny days per year. The US average is 205 sunny days.

Tullahoma, Tennessee gets 57.5 inches of rain, on average, per year. Tyler, Texas gets 46 inches of rain, on average, per year. The US average is 38.1 inches of rain per year.

Tullahoma averages 2.8 inches of snow per year. Tyler averages 1 inches of snow per year. The US average is 27.8 inches of snow per year.

August is the hottest month for Tyler with an average high temperature of 93.8°, which ranks it as cooler than most places in Texas. In Tyler, there are 3 comfortable months with high temperatures in the range of 70-85°. The most pleasant months of the year for Tyler are October, April and May.

July is the hottest month for Tullahoma with an average high temperature of 86.4°, which ranks it as cooler than most places in Tennessee. In Tullahoma, there are 4 comfortable months with high temperatures in the range of 70-85°. The most pleasant months of the year for Tullahoma are May, September and June.
January has the coldest nighttime temperatures for Tyler with an average of 36.2°. This is about average compared to other places in Texas.

January has the coldest nighttime temperatures for Tullahoma with an average of 26.8°. This is warmer than most places in Tennessee.

In Tyler, there are 77.6 days annually when the high temperature is over 90°, which is cooler than most places in Texas.

In Tullahoma, there are 18.6 days annually when the high temperature is over 90°, which is cooler than most places in Tennessee.

In Tyler, there are 32.6 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below freezing, which is about average compared to other places in Texas.

In Tullahoma, there are 84.1 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below freezing, which is about average compared to other places in Tennessee.

In Tyler, there are 0.0 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below zero°, which is about average compared to other places in Texas.

In Tullahoma, there are 0.3 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below zero°, which is warmer than most places in Tennessee.

October is the wettest month in Tyler with 5.0 inches of rain, and the driest month is July with 2.7 inches. The wettest season is Winter with 27% of yearly precipitation and 22% occurs in Autumn, which is the driest season. The annual rainfall of 46.0 inches in Tyler means that it is wetter than most places in Texas.


December is the wettest month in Tullahoma with 5.8 inches of rain, and the driest month is October with 3.4 inches. The wettest season is Spring with 28% of yearly precipitation and 22% occurs in Winter, which is the driest season. The annual rainfall of 57.5 inches in Tullahoma means that it is one of the wettest places in Tennessee.

December is the rainiest month in Tyler with 8.3 days of rain, and August is the driest month with only 5.3 rainy days. There are 85.8 rainy days annually in Tyler, which is rainier than most places in Texas. The rainiest season is Spring when it rains 28% of the time and the driest is Autumn with only a 22% chance of a rainy day.

December is the rainiest month in Tullahoma with 11.7 days of rain, and September is the driest month with only 7.9 rainy days. There are 125.3 rainy days annually in Tullahoma, which is rainier than most places in Tennessee. The rainiest season is Spring when it rains 27% of the time and the driest is Winter with only a 21% chance of a rainy day.

An annual snowfall of 1.0 inches in Tyler means that it is snowier than most places in Texas.

An annual snowfall of 2.8 inches in Tullahoma means that it is less snowy than most places in Tennessee.
February is the snowiest month in Tyler with 0.5 inches of snow, and 1 month of the year have significant snowfall.

February is the snowiest month in Tullahoma with 0.9 inches of snow, and 3 months of the year have significant snowfall.

DID YOU KNOW?

Many people confuse Weather and Climate, but they are different. Weather refers to the conditions of the atmosphere over a short period of time, while Climate refers to the conditions of the atmosphere over a long period of time.

Weather, more specifically, refers to how the atmosphere behaves and its effects on life and human activities. Most people think of Weather in terms of what can be observed: temperature, humidity, precipitation, and cloudy/sunny conditions. Weather conditions constantly change on a minute-to-minute basis.

Climate is a record of the average weather conditions for a given place over a long period of time, often referred to as Climate Normals. A 30-year period of record is a common requirement to be considered a Climate Normal.
